Repair for cracks and chips
For safe driving, you must ensure that your windshield is free of chips and cracks. Small cracks can cause glass to break and pose danger to your safety. These tiny pits can be fixed however, a more effective and lasting solution is to have your windshield replaced.
There are a variety of windshield repair kits available. Each kit uses a distinct resin blend and tools to repair the damage. Depending on the severity of damage, one kind of chip will perform better than the other.
If you're looking to find a simple way to keep your windshield clear of chips and scratches, it could be the right choice. It could be a danger as it can cause damage to the windshield's structural integrity.
If you've got larger cracks it could be possible to replace the entire windshield. If you're lucky, your insurance will cover the cost. The cost of replacing your windshield could be anywhere between a few hundred and over 1000 dollars. You need to replace or repair your windshield as quickly as possible.
A successful glass repair requires the use of the right mix of polymer resins that make sure the damage is sealed. This will prevent any further damage from occurring. The resin will help restore the clarity of your windshield.

Preparing the glass for re-glazing
Depending on the type of glass, you'll require glazing compound to hold the glass in the right place. You can either use an oil-based primer or latex paint. If you choose to use oil-based primers, ensure that it's a high-quality brand.
To avoid paint chipping, employ a drop cloth. Also, gloves are recommended. To smooth the glaze, you should use a putty knives.
Clean the frame of dust and debris after taking off the old glazing. Apply an oil-based primer for the exterior of the frame. Make sure you leave at least one/16th inch of room for the glass to fit. This will allow the points of the glazier to hold the glass.
After the primer has dried, you can add glazing beads to your glass. These beads should be cut with a knife blade on either side of the mullion. After the new glass is installed, it may stick to the glass along the edge of the bead.
After trimming the bead after trimming, you need to apply the silicone caulk to the glass. The silicone should be placed between five and six inches from the corners. You can also use a caulk gun to complete the job. After the caulk has been applied and dried, you can apply a moistening finger and use it for smoothing the caulk.
Laminated safety glass
Laminate safety glass can make your home more secure. It can be used to guard your home from noise from outside and also to protect your home from forced entry.
Although this product is commonly employed for residential use however, it can also be beneficial for commercial buildings. In fact, it's frequently used for skylights in high-end structures.
This kind of glass can be installed inside your business or home at the moment that is appropriate. In addition to offering excellent security, it also provides a few other perks. These include UV protection, less visual distortion and hurricane impact glass.
It's not the most cost-effective glass on the market, but it does have certain advantages over other kinds of safety glass. While the other types of glass are susceptible to breaking the laminated glass can endure repeated hits.
It is made by applying heat to a glass sheet, and after that, fusing two or more layers together. This produces a strong, durable material that is also much less expensive than normal glass.
Laminate glass can also be cut. This is especially crucial for commercial structures. It is also more difficult to penetrate than normal glass that has been annealed.
It is also available in a wide range of shapes, sizes and thicknesses. You can even have it made according to your specifications.

Removal of a damaged window
It is possible to repair broken windows by using the right tools and materials. Wearing the proper protective gear, such as safety glasses as well as thick gloves and long sleeves is a must. It is also an excellent idea to cover the area surrounding the glass with a cloth. This will stop glass fragments from flying off.
The first step is to remove any old glue that holds the glass in place. One way to do this is with a heat gun. This will to soften the adhesive. You can also use a jackknife to cut the putty off.
Once the old putty has been removed and the old putty is gone, you can begin to remove the broken glass. Some windows are secured with triangular nail fasteners, which usually have three or two on either side of the pane. They are difficult to take out, and so you might require a knife.
After you have taken out the glass, you can replace it. You will need to choose the right glass for replacement and the proper measurements. This job can be performed by home improvement centers. You might also have to take down the frame.
The next step is to apply painter's tape to the glass to keep it firmly in place. Be cautious not to press too much against the glass, as this can cause damage. Masking tape is recommended for both the interior and exterior. This will keep the glass from flying away and landing in the wrong place.
